Output 20a2c06686b31161ac12d6a5757732a44f60adc3392af029bd54752dff9b31e4:1

value
26870000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fdebc97bd75d43cbfa75b1c33c8de1521e8c82e5 OP_EQUAL
address
3QqdLr8xWWdKvXXvZGb5mTmzHyVpZURry6
transaction
20a2c06686b31161ac12d6a5757732a44f60adc3392af029bd54752dff9b31e4
confirmations
462063
spent
true